Abstract

The influence of different silica fume content on the slump, expansion, compressive strength and flexural strength of high-performance concrete was studied. The results show that with the increase of silica fume content, the slump, expansion, compressive strength, and flexural strength of high-performance concrete show a trend of increasing first and then decreasing. The optimal silica fume content of HPC(Highperformance concrete) is 3% to 6%.
